Summary: | The publication aims to address major policy implications of population ageing in Asia and the Pacific and review successful cases in developing national policies and programmes on ageing. The publication is divided into four parts. Part one discusses the social and economic consequences and policy implications of ageing in Asia and the Pacific. Part two presents the approach followed by the Government of Australia in developing the national policy and strategy in meeting the challenges of ageing. Part three examines the case study of HelpAge India in providing support to older persons in emergencies while the last part, Part four presents the case study of the Tsao Foundation in Singapore in developing an integrated system of community-based care for older persons.
